31 ft
Up to 6 people
Hampton Roads Charters
45 ft
Earning Stripes Sportfishing
50 ft
Top Dog Charters - Cape Charles, VA
46 ft
Big Dog Charters
36 ft
Payback Sportfishing LLC
Showing 71 - 75